His best girl, Louise Camoron, ...See moreRoy Berrick receives an invitation to attend a fancy dress ball. He looks around for a good costume and meeting Dusty Rhodes, a tramp, he copies his dress and makes up as near like Rhodes as possible. His best girl, Louise Camoron, scarcely knows him when he calls for her. Dusty Rhodes adds to the day's taking at a nearby saloon, burning up the money he received from Roy. He endeavors to get away with a large portion of the free lunch counter, and after rudely jabbing the gentleman, who dispenses beverages to thirty customers, in the eye, he is chased down the street by an energetic copper, assisted by others in search of excitement. Dusty conceals himself in an old ash barrel until his anxious friends have overlooked his close vicinity, when he emerges and saunters off. Roy leaves Louise at the entrance of the club house, where the ball is being given. In order to fix his beard, which has become loose. Dusty strolls up and Louise pounces upon him (believing him to be Roy), and takes Dusty in. Dusty is delighted. Dusty and one of the dancers soon seek the refreshment bar and proceed to load up. Roy comes in and is sent by Louise to find her fan in the waiting auto. As he is looking for it, the hot and indignant copper appears and despite Roy's frantic remonstrance drags him off to durance vile. In the meantime, Dusty has a royal time and Louise thinks he is playing his part far too naturally and is disgusted with him. Dusty gets busy with the glasses and the crockery, and is arrested and run in. Louise follows to the station where the tangle is unraveled. Written by Moving Picture World synopsis See less
